I began writing "Things Left Unsaid" without even realizing I was creating a project. Living in LA, you see a lot of strange things accompanied by very unique people. Like most humans, you conjure thoughts and opinions about just about anything you see. I opened my Notes app on my phone and began with the words "To the..." and the rest is basically history. It dawned on me that I have a lot of words and things I wish I did say, could say, or want to say to a variety of different people. Despite being confident, I have my moments when I'm not courageous enough to address another human. So, "Things Left Unsaid" was born.
I have a best friend that hears about all my ideas when they're in motion...I mean all of them (shoutout to you, woman!) I was a little hesitant about the reaction for this book because I wasn't sure if the idea was solidified or even flushed out enough. But, alas, we thought it was a keeper. We complied a list of people we would have words for, and I chose the ones I thought that most could also relate to. There are, per usual, more personal letters to specific people, but even those I think many can relate to.
I wanted to kick off 2020 with something that would set the tone for the remainder of the year. I definitely think I succeeded with that one!
